In the annals of folklore, humanoid hybrids—part human, part beast—have woven themselves into the cultural fabric of societies around the world. From the Egyptians to the Hindus, from the Greeks to the Japanese, these tales have been passed down through generations, often transforming into something unrecognizable from their origins. However, one legend, the Owlman of Mawnan, stands out as a relatively new tale that has captivated the imagination of many.

In 1926, a local newspaper in Cornwall reported a harrowing incident involving two boys who were chased by a massive and ferocious bird. Initially dismissed as the product of an overactive imagination, subsequent sightings of a half-man, half-bird creature known as the Owlman of Mawnan have kept the legend alive.

Fast forward to 1976, when two young girls reported seeing an abnormally large bird, resembling a giant owl, flying over the 13th-century Parish Church in Mawnan Smith. The girls, traumatized by their encounter, cut short their holiday and returned home. Two years later, two witnesses described a large, silver-gray bird that emitted a strange static noise as it flew away.

In 1989 and again in 1995, the Owlman made more appearances, with witnesses describing a creature at least 5 feet tall with huge wings and large claws. One American tourist, a marine biology student, described her encounter with the Owlman as "a vision from Hell," sending a letter to a local newspaper detailing her experience.

Despite these accounts, the Owlman remained relatively quiet until 2009, when a 12-year-old girl spotted the creature near Mawnan church, describing it as other witnesses had. Some have suggested that the Owlman might be an escaped great gray owl, but this theory has been dismissed due to the longevity of the sightings.
